我建立了一个网站,客户可以在指定日期租用机器。
我使用PHP和MYSQL。 here is an image显示我的表格和所需的关系。
我需要输出账单。该账单应包含客户数据,租用的机器以及他选择的日期。客户可以租用多台机器,每台机器可以租用多个日期,这些日期可以是非连续的。
如何进行查询以返回帐单所需的所有数据?
答案 0 :(得分:0)
你的问题是关于SQL句子,无论你是否使用php。
以下查询将起作用:
选择a.firstname,b.machine,d.from,d.to FROM rents as a,maschines 作为b,renInfo为c,rentDates为d WHERE c.rid = a.id AND c.mid = b.id AND c.id = d.riid ORDER BY a.firstname,b.machine,d.from,d.to